KTUG 한국 텍 사용자 그룹

Menu

KTUG :: Q&A 마당

첫번째 RSA 어쩌구는 indexentry가 두 개가 있는데 하나는 위치지정(@)을 하고 하나는 안 해서 생긴 문제입니다.

두 개를 똑같이 만들면 해결될 것 같습니다. 즉, 문서 어디선가 \index{RSA 암호체계}라고 한 것을 (모두) \index{아르에스에이@RSA 암호체계}로 수정하십시오.


두번째 문제는 팩토리얼 기호와 index subitem 지정에 쓰이는 !가 같은 문자라서 생긴 혼선입니다.

preamble에

\protected\def\factorial{!}

과 같은 명령을 하나 정의하고 \index 엔트리에서는 ! 대신 이것을 써야겠네요.

\index{차례곱 ($n\factorial $)}


그리고 잠깐 테스트하다 보니 idx 안에 @@와 같은 입력이 있던데, 수정해야 할 것 같습니다.

idx가 이 상태라면 komkindex가 더 원활하게 돌 것 같습니다. xindy로 제대로 처리되게 하려면 $ 기호, \로 시작하는 tex 명령, \"와 같은 방식으로 식자한 문자들 가운데 xindy가 이해하지 못하는 것들을 모두 xdy로 제공해야 하는데... 그 일이 더 많을 듯...

참고로, index 엔트리를 만들 때 수식 표현이 들어간다면 예컨대 다음과 같이 하는 것이 안전합니다.


\index{제곱근 (\ensuremath{\sqrt{2}})}


즉, $를 쓰지 말라는 것입니다. 일반적으로 $$는 아예 쓰지 말아야 하고 $는 되도록 쓰지 않아야 합니다.


KTUG 한국 텍 사용자 그룹